Medical Records Transcription Supervisor jobs in Asheville, NC

Medical Records Transcription Supervisor supervises daily activities of the medical transcription department to optimize productivity. Assigns, schedules and oversees the work of the transcription area of the department. Being a Medical Records Transcription Supervisor ensures that physician's dictations are completed correctly and promptly. May perform transcriptions as needed. Additionally, Medical Records Transcription Supervisor may require an associate degree or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. May require Certified Medical Transcriptionist (CMT). The Medical Records Transcription Supervisor sup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. Thorough knowledge of department processes. To be a Medical Records Transcription Supervisor typ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    What you will do:

     

    • Organize and maintain facility medical records system in compliance with corporate, state and federal regulations.
    • Code and quantify records from admission to discharge.
    • Maintain a documented, organized system, which is readily accessible by other authorized professionals.
    • Ensure that all reports are completed within established time frames.
    • Maintain the resident census on a daily basis.
    • Maintain a current list of each physician’s residents and send to the physician quarterly.
    • Pull charts for physicians’ rounds each week and ensure that documentation is present.
    • Monitor Restraint and Bowel & Bladder Programs to insure documentation is present.
    • Audit MAR and Treatment Sheets weekly.
    • Audit Narcotic count sheets weekly.
    • Perform chart audits.
    • File lab and x-ray reports on charts daily.
    • Review physician orders (including telephone orders) and monitor to be sure that lab, x-ray, diagnostic tests, consultations, etc., have been scheduled and followed through.
    • Ensure that MDS documentation is placed in resident’s medical record and that documentation is complete.
    • Schedule care plan meetings.
    • Notify family and staff thirty (30) days in advance of care plan meeting, fifteen (15) days in advance and one (1) week in advance.

Asheville is a city and the county seat of Buncombe County, North Carolina, United States. It is the largest city in Western North Carolina, and the 12th-most populous city in the U.S. state of North Carolina. The city's population was 89,121 according to 2016 estimates. It is the principal city in the four-county Asheville metropolitan area, with a population of 424,858 in 2010. Asheville is located in the Blue Ridge Mountains at the confluence of the Swannanoa River and the French Broad River.
